FL15 SZF is a 2015 Citroen Nemo in White with a 1,248c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 10 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 90%.
Across all 2015 Citroen Nemo models, the average MOT pass rate is 73.6% with a typical mileage of 73,601 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Citroen Nemo f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 4,767 recorded failures. If you're considering buying FL15 SZF,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Citroen Nemo typically stays on UK roads for around 18 years. At 11 years old, this Citroen Nemo is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
